Thatch is usually a nutritious, useful component of your respective lawn. And never each individual lawn will need dethatching. But when thatch turns into way too thick, it could inhibit wholesome turf development. When that comes about, it may be time and energy to dethatch.

Worst of all, If the thatch grows too thick, plant roots is probably not ready to penetrate, and the roots will expand totally in the thatch layer. This leaves them prone to both equally drought and overwatering or every other form of strain.

Cool-Season Grasses Dethatching works best in the event the lawn is expanding and also the soil is relatively moist. Amazing-year grasses really should be dethatched in the early spring or early tumble.

Dethatching your lawn might be really hard on sure grass types like tall fescue or rye grass. These bunch style grasses don’t have a chance to Get well as speedily as kentucky bluegrass or bermuda grass from dethatching. It truly is best to intend to overseed soon after dethatching tall fescues and rye grass.

Interesting-season grasses: Perennial ryegrass and tall fescue lawns don’t usually Possess a thatch problem. Kentucky bluegrass, creeping crimson fescue, and creeping bentgrass lawns build extra thatch due to their dense, intense website rhizome and stolon expansion.

There are a few various ways to dethatch your lawn. You can use a dethatcher, or you can dethatch by hand.

Try to pick a spring or drop working day to dethatch, and h2o your lawn two or three days ahead of time in order to avoid harming it. Also, water check here your lawn again proper Once you dethatch to help you it Get well.
